Vision Statement
Alfred E. Zampella School has a proud tradition of excellence and solid achievement. Our motto is, “We strive for excellence.” This excellence, on each student’s learning level, is sought daily by addressing the needs of the total child. We strive to develop literate, lifelong learners, who are responsible and involved citizens.

Alfred E. Zampella School has implemented programs and activities that will prepare our students for this new millennium’s competitive workplace. Our dedicated, caring, and concerned faculty has high expectations for all students, with objectives culled from careful test analyses, informal assessments, and daily observations. As we fulfill our vision, all students will be meeting the New Jersey Core Curriculum Content Standards and will be able to read on grade level by the end of third grade.

Our Co-nect Design Team and Committees are active and have met their annual goals. We will continue to maintain committees as needed in the future. We will also maintain the positions of Co-nect Facilitator, Technology Coordinator, Reading Recovery Teachers, Reading Specialist, and Guidance Counselors. Alfred E. Zampella School’s educational technology initiative has grown by leaps and bounds, enriching and extending teaching and learning.

New state of the art computers have been installed in our classrooms, media center and computer lab. We plan to continue to close the achievement gap between general education students and special needs students by continuing our full inclusion program. We will continue to offer character education through the guidance counselors, and we will continue to infuse technology throughout the curriculum with the help of our Technology Coordinator, and the current Whole School Reform Facilitator. We will continue to use project-based learning, and our principal will continue to be a strong leader for our school.
